Transaction 66e9e86e395a84494927f452a5da1c04bc7f63990af45d8922124a632ae8600c
1 Input
1 Output
-
66e9e86e395a84494927f452a5da1c04bc7f63990af45d8922124a632ae8600c:0
- value
- 70884
- script pubkey
- OP_0 OP_PUSHBYTES_20 7c21a0be1fb003f4ef61fb1ab01d0b7312e6f4a4
- address
- bc1q0ss6p0slkqplfmmplvdtq8gtwvfwda9y44ask6